I definitely collect for both...but I have been very interested n the backs for over 20 years. The fronts are easy...you can find almost any t206 front for sale at any given time. Definitely not so for the backs. A rare back merely enhances the overall appeal of a card...in my opinion. Anybody can find a red t206 cobb...but try finding a coupon type I or any of the tougher backs...makes collecting much more interesting! And to neglect the tobacco companies involved in the distribution of our beloved t cards would be to ignore a valuable link to their history and to a point in time in america.
